Every parents look forward to a brilliant and excellent future for their growing child and youth, they will go extra mile to give them right morals and values necessary for their upbringing. But it is sad to know that certain areas of negligence on the part of the parents and guardians is simply one of the major reasons for the frontal decadence in our youth today. However in the bid to show parents where and how to safe guard and allow moral wellbeing of their youth "BRO JERO" a friction and yet real life experience unveils the extreme significant of parents responsibility to discover areas of vulnerability their growing children and youths may be facing as they progress in the pursuit of their dreams. It express the need for youth to make rightful decisions that are not selfish but contribute to the development of the society in the pursuit of their dreams. The book also express the "Never give up" theory inspite of down fall and discouragement and the need to acknowledge God in every situation.
